🌬️ Superhero Breath Blast

Ever wish you could zap stress like a superhero? This theme turns you into a Breath Hero! Picture this: you and your pals wear capes (DIY ones, because glitter glue is life) and practice “superpower breaths.” Deep inhales through your nose, slow exhales like you’re blowing out a gazillion candles. One kid at a party I heard about, Timmy, age 7, said he felt like Spider-Man shooting webs of calm. Set up a “Breath Obstacle Course” with hula hoops to leap through while breathing slowly. Add a “Villain Freeze” game—when the music stops, everyone freezes and takes three deep breaths. It’s like hitting pause on a wild cartoon! For snacks, serve “Power Puffs” (veggie-stuffed puff pastries) to fuel those mighty lungs.

🦁 Jungle Zen Jamboree

Roar! This party’s a wild ride through a mindfulness jungle. Transform your backyard or living room into a leafy paradise with paper vines and stuffed animals. Kids become “Zen Explorers,” learning to breathe like animals. Try “Lion’s Breath”—stick out your tongue, exhale loudly, and scare away worries. My neighbor’s kid, Lila, cracked up doing this at her birthday, saying it made her tummy feel “all giggly and light.” Set up a “Mindful Safari” where kids crawl under tables (caves!) and pause to breathe at each “watering hole” (blue blankets). Hand out fruit skewers as “Jungle Sticks” for a healthy munch. Music? Jungle drums on a Bluetooth speaker to keep the vibe chill yet bouncy.

🌈 Rainbow Breath Bonanza

Colors make everything better, right? This theme’s a blast of hues that teach kids to breathe their way to calm. Each color links to a feeling—red for energy, blue for peace, yellow for joy. Kids pick a color and breathe while thinking of something that matches (like blue for a calm ocean). At one party, 9-year-old Mia painted a rainbow on her cheek and said, “Breathing blue makes me feel like I’m floating!” Create a “Rainbow Relay” where kids run to colored stations, grab a scarf, and do five slow breaths. Decorate with rainbow streamers and serve “Rainbow Fruit Cups” (layered berries, mango, and kiwi). Crank up some upbeat pop tunes to keep the energy sparkling.

🪐 Space Serenity Soirée

Blast off to a galaxy of calm! This space-themed party lets kids explore mindfulness like astronauts. Picture glow-in-the-dark stars on the ceiling and kids in tinfoil helmets. They practice “Star Breaths”—inhale while reaching up, exhale while curling into a ball, like a star collapsing and shining again. A kid named Jayden once told me he felt “like a comet zooming to happy land” after this. Set up a “Moonwalk Meditation” where kids tiptoe slowly, breathing with each step. Serve “Galaxy Bites” (blueberry yogurt bites with edible glitter) for a cosmic snack. Play spacey ambient music to make it feel like you’re floating in orbit.

🐝 Bumblebee Buzz Bash

Bzzz! This party’s all about buzzing like bees while staying super mindful. Kids love the “Bee Breath”—humming exhales that vibrate their chests. One 6-year-old, Sammy, said it made him feel “like a happy motorboat!” Dress up with yellow and black headbands, and set up a “Honeycomb Hunt” where kids find hidden paper hexagons while pausing to hum-breathe. Create a “Flower Garden” corner with pillows for kids to sit and breathe quietly, imagining they’re bees on a petal. Serve “Honey Drizzles” (apple slices with a honey dip) for a sweet, healthy treat. Add some bouncy acoustic guitar music to keep the mood sunny and buzzy.

🎉 Tips to Make Your Bash a Blast

  • Keep it Short: Kids’ attention spans are like goldfish—quick! Do 5-minute mindfulness games between dancing and snacks.
  • Mix It Up: Blend active games (like relays) with calm moments (like breathing breaks) to match kids’ energy.
  • Get Crafty: Let kids make capes, helmets, or headbands. It’s fun and doubles as a party favor.
  • Healthy Eats: Skip the candy overload. Fruit, veggies, and fun shapes (like star-shaped sandwiches) keep kids fueled without the crash.
  • Kid-Friendly Tunes: Pick music that’s upbeat but not screamy. Think pop or acoustic, not heavy metal.
